What is special about Oakley Prizm?

Oakley Prizm lenses are performance sunglass lenses designed specifically for sports like baseball, fishing, golf, skiing, and biking. Instead of just blocking light—and making everything harder to see—Prizm lenses boost certain wavelengths of color vision, so you can see even more detail.

Is PRIZM better than polarized?

No. Like we said above, a polarized lens isn't always better than a non-polarized lens. Many of the PRIZM Sport lenses are not polarized because of the issue with depth perception. Needless to say, maintaining hand-eye coordination and depth perception is an essential part of many sports.

What is Oakley's PRIZM technology?

What is PRIZM? PRIZM is Oakley's proprietary lens technology that fine-tunes vision for specific environments. PRIZM lenses emphasize colors where the eye is most sensitive to detail, which in-turn helps to enhance performance, safety, and your overall experience.

What is the difference between Oakley polarized and PRIZM?

Some Oakley Prizm lenses, like Prizm Field Lenses, are polarized, meaning they include a filter to block glare from reflected light. Prizm lenses don't mean polarized—it's an entirely different lens technology. Whereas polarized lenses block glare from reflected light, Prizm lenses amplify what you're seeing.

Do Oakley Prizm lenses block blue light?

Prizm lenses are made from Plutonite, Oakley's high purity optical-grade polycarbonate, to protect wearers from fragments that could damage eyes. All lenses also block 100% of UVA, UVB, UVC, and harmful violet-blue light up to 400nm.
